In this three-week course, students will learn to write narratives. Narratives tell a story of a single event, instance, or experience. The purpose is to show how this experience significantly impacted one's life. Narratives can vary in length but always show the importance of this single moment. More specifically, personal narratives are common prompts for both high school and college. By writing your own narrative, you demonstrate the importance of things in your own life and how they are important in others as well! 

This course is designed to prepare students for college personal narrative writing. These are traditional entrance essays or college application essays so we are focusing on developing these skills in this course!
